Iztuzu Beach: Where Nature and History Meet

Iztuzu Beach is located in the Dalyan region of the Ortaca district of Muğla, not only in Turkey, is considered one of the most special corners of the world. This beach, which attracts attention with its golden sands, clear waters and unique ecosystem, has become one of the indispensable addresses of those looking for an environmentally friendly holiday.

Location and Transport

Iztuzu Beach is located approximately 12 kilometres from the centre of Dalyan. Road or boat route can be preferred to reach this unique beach. Boats departing from Dalyan canals offer both a pleasant view and a fun travel experience for visitors. For those who prefer the highway, smooth asphalt roads can be reached.

Natural Beauties of Iztuzu Beach

Surrounded by the deep blue waters of the Mediterranean on one side and the Dalyan Delta on the other, Iztuzu Beach has a coastline of 4.5 kilometres. The golden yellow fine sand of the beach dazzles in the summer season, while the sea is shallow and suitable for children. Since the wave level is generally low, it is an ideal choice for families with children.

Caretta Caretta Turtle Protection Area

Iztuzu Beach is famous not only for its beauty but also as a spawning ground for Caretta caretta sea turtles. These endangered species come to Iztuzu Beach between May and September and lay their eggs here. For this reason, special measures have been taken in certain areas of the beach to protect the turtles. Visitors are expected to pay attention to these areas and not to damage nature.

Historical and Mythological Links

Iztuzu Beach is intertwined with history and mythology as well as its natural beauties. The ancient city of Kaunos in the Dalyan region was an important centre of the Lycian civilisation. The king tombs and ancient theatre here offer an impressive sightseeing route for visitors interested in history. Especially the details of the king tombs carved into the rocks emphasise the importance of this region throughout history.

Protection Measures at Iztuzu Beach

Iztuzu Beach was taken under protection in 1988 and adopted an environmentally sensitive tourism approach. In this context, there is no construction on the beach and commercial activities are limited. The facilities on the beach are organised to meet the basic needs of visitors. At the same time, the beach is closed at night to prevent damage to turtle nests.
